Macquarie University Physiotherapy School Postgraduate Entry

  

Overview

The Macquarie Physiotherapy program is the only three-year masters-level, professional-entry physiotherapy course in New South Wales.  This will develop your skills so that when you graduate you’re able to work with individuals across the lifespan to optimize their physical function. You’ll learn to effectively assess, diagnose and treat individuals with a wide range of health conditions. You’ll also learn how to encourage people to change their behaviour and self-manage their conditions to maximize their physical health. This degree is accredited with the Australian Physiotherapy Council and approved by the Physiotherapy Board of Australia, meaning that as a graduate, you’re eligible to apply for registration with the Australian Health Practitioner Regulation Agency (AHPRA).

Clinical Placements

Macquarie’s combination of coursework with more than 1000 hours of supervised clinical practice means that you’ll graduate career ready with the skills to effectively assess, diagnose, treat and educate people with movement disorders.

Entry Requirements

Entry Requirements

Successful completion of a Bachelor degree from recognized institution with a minimum GPA of 65%

Applicants need recent successful completion of at least one tertiary unit in each of the following areas:

  • Human anatomy (musculoskeletal and system)
  • Human physiology (cell and system)
  • Psychology
  • Research methods

The following tertiary level units are desired knowledge areas:

  • Biomechanics
  • Exercise Physiology
  • Motor Learning and Performance
  • Neuroscience
  • Pathophysiology
  • Pharmacology.

Professional Recognition

Professional Recognition

Macquarie’s Doctor of Physiotherapy program has been accredited by the Australian Physiotherapy Council and approved by the Physiotherapy Board of Australia. Graduates will be eligible to apply to register and practice as a physiotherapist.

Students wishing to license as a physiotherapist in Canada should contact the Canadian Alliance of Physiotherapy Regulators for procedures and accreditation procedures. The CAPR is the national federation of provincial/territorial regulators in Canada.

Leading Telescope Science and Technology Group Moves To Macquarie University


Image from Leading Telescope Science and Technology Group Moves To Macquarie University

Effective 1 July, has assumed responsibility for the research and optical instrumentation capability of the Australian Astronomical Observatory, a group with 45 years of excellence in astronomy instrumentation.

The group will be known as AAO-Macquarie and will partner with the University of Sydney, the Australian National University, and Astronomy Australia Limited to form a collaborative national capability for astronomical instrumentation, Australian Astronomical Optics (AAO).

ABOUT THE PROGRAM
Award Title:Doctor of Physiotherapy
Length of Program:3 years Full Time
Next Intake:July
Selection Interview:Not Required
Application Deadline:end of January
Number of Seats AvailableAbout 20 Spots for International Students
Tuition Fees:Approx. $54,800 AUD for the first year
Faculty:Medicine, Health and Human Sciences
Country:Australia
